Grilled Chicken In A Peanut Pasta Bowl
From rottman 14 years agoIngredients
- 1 handful of angel hair pasta (1 inch diameter) shopping list
- 1 bunch broccoli florets shopping list
- 4 oz Grilled chicken, Purdue Short Cuts, shopping list
- 3 Tb asian peanut sauce shopping list
- 1 tsp salt shopping list
- 2 Tb chopped red bell pepper shopping list
How to make it
- This recipe is for one. Adjust it accordingly.
- Cut the florets from a small bunch of broccoli. Add to a pot with a 1/2 inch water plus a sprinkle of salt. Cover and bring to a boil to briefly steam.
- In a 2 qt pot, boil 1 qt water plus 1 tsp salt to a boil. Add the angel hair pasta and cook to your desired consistency.
- Place the chicken on a paper plate and heat 30-40 seconds in the microwave.
- When the pasta is done, drain. Add 3 Tb peanut sauce and stir. Peanut sauces differ in flavor, so choose one you are familiar with an appreciate.
- Add the steamed florets and the chopped red bell pepper.
- Serve.
